Swedish tourist visits the Madeira Islands for the 52nd time
Add to my brochure   Kjell Bergtsson
The Regional Secretariat of Tourism and Transport has paid tribute to Swedish tourist Kjell Bergtsson because he has visited the Madeira Islands on holiday more than 50 times.  
This is something that is happening more and more often nowadays, but is always worth mentioning, because it shows that tourists are pleased with the Madeira Islands. This is an important factor for promoting the Madeira Islands as a holiday destination
Having visited the Madeira Islands 52 times since his first trip here in 1977, Kjell says that he enjoys the pleasant climate and the natural beauty of the archipelago, and that the people are very welcoming. He likes to stroll along the paths to explore the interior of the islands, and he greatly approves the fact that several streets in Funchal have been closed to vehicles, especially Avenida Arriaga, where there is now a lot less traffic.

What are 'levadas'?

Levadas are water courses running round the mountains and were built by the first settlers to carry water to inaccessible farmland. Today they are one of Madeira’s greatest tourist attractions.(more)
